Transaction 7b5d941464c77c74a43157ae35b32952b9995cc1b663f08e2249b3a2faccba09
1 Input
1 Output
-
7b5d941464c77c74a43157ae35b32952b9995cc1b663f08e2249b3a2faccba09:0
- value
- 518605867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f41b3e5d4a1919380c180c585fd759214ce889fa OP_EQUAL
- address
- 3PwjSGbN6CeGjd8yDzXuDkwAzjhGq9WqHs